More WWE Live Event Only Moments Being Considered Following Jamie Noble’s Last Match
A new report has claimed that WWE are going to be trying to create more unique moments on live events like Jamie Noble had this weekend.
This past Sunday 11th December, Jamie Noble donned his ring gear one more time for a retirement match during a WWE live event in his hometown of Charleston, West Virginia. With his family in attendance, Noble teamed with Braun Strowman and the Brawling Brutes combination of Ridge Holland and Butch in a victory over The Bloodline, with the retiring superstar getting the decisive victory over Sami Zayn.
In a new report from Fightful Select, it would seem that whilst this was designed as a nice moment for Noble to officially step away from the squared circle, WWE are not done with having special appearances like this as part of their live events schedule.
We were told that more things like Jamie Noble wrestling at a WWE live event — that we wouldn’t normally see on WWE TV — are ‘on the table’ for the current WWE regime.
During his in-ring career, Jamie Noble held the Ring Of Honor World Championship as well as being a WWE Cruiserweight Champion. He has worked as a producer for WWE since 2012 and made sporadic appearances on television during that time either in full on-screen roles or acting as additional security.

This new remit would seem to allow additional one-off appearances, whilst also helping to make the product you see in the arena a “one-off” rather than the same as what you can see every week on television.
